I was told by Tim Larison (dvctalk email list and travel agent) that it is 8 cabins. I don't know what the benefit it for certian so I won't venture my guesses. Tim did tell me that he has been able to combine groups to get the discount in at least one situation.
 
Group rates apply when you book a minimum of 8 staterooms with 16 adult fares. There is a small discount and other group benefits as well.
